Paul Light analyzes how presidents from Kennedy to Clinton set and pursued their domestic policy agendas amid shifting political conditions.

About This Book

This book examines domestic policy decisions made by American presidents between 1961 and 2001.

It explores the factors that influence presidential agenda-setting and policy priorities over multiple administrations.

The study draws on historical records to identify patterns in how presidents approach domestic issues.

Readers gain insight into the political and institutional constraints that shape policy choices.
